Explore the beauty and rhythm of life through the insightful essays of Alice Meynell in "The Rhythm of Life, and Other Essays." This collection offers a profound meditation on nature, beauty, and the everyday experiences that shape our lives. Meynell's elegant prose delves into philosophical reflections on life's general rhythms and offers a unique perspective on literary subjects. These essays, long admired for their clarity and grace, explore themes relevant to both literary criticism and general philosophy.
